vue是什么需要

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ue(发音/vjuː/,或视为"view")是一个用于构建用户界面的渐进式 JavaScript 框架。它是目前非常流行的前端框架之一,由尤雨溪开发并维护。Vue具有简单易学、高效灵活和功能丰富的特点,使得它成为开发现代化 Web 应用程序的理想选择。

    Vue的核心思想是将用户界面(UI)的构建和数据的渲染逻辑分离,通过响应式的数据绑定,实现了UI与数据的高度耦合。Vue采用了虚拟DOM(Virtual DOM)技术,通过观察数据的变化,动态地更新页面上的DOM元素,从而使页面保持同步更新的状态。

    Vue具有以下特点和优势:

    1. 简单易学:Vue的语法简洁明了,学习曲线较低,适合初学者使用。
    2. 渐进式框架:Vue的设计理念是渐进式,可以逐步应用到现有的项目中,也可以一步步引入更多的高级特性和库,满足不同项目的需求。
    3. 组件化开发:Vue将页面拆分成多个独立的组件,每个组件都有自己的样式、模板和逻辑,可以复用和组合,提高代码的可维护性和复用性。
    4. 响应式数据绑定:Vue通过数据劫持和观察者模式实现了响应式的数据绑定,使页面上的元素能够即时地反应数据的变化。
    5. 虚拟DOM技术:Vue通过虚拟DOM技术实现了高效的页面更新,只更新发生变化的部分,提高了页面的渲染性能。
    6. 生态系统丰富:Vue拥有一个活跃的社区和丰富的生态系统,有大量的插件和工具可供选择,满足各种开发需求。

    总之,Vue是一种现代化的前端框架,帮助开发者构建高效、灵活和功能丰富的Web应用程序。无论是小型项目还是大型项目,Vue都是一个非常好的选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ue是一种用于构建用户界面的JavaScript框架。它通过采用组件化的方式来构建应用程序,并提供了大量的工具和功能来简化开发过程。

    1. Vue是一种轻量级的框架,而且易于学习和使用。它提供了清晰简洁的API,使得开发者可以快速上手并构建复杂的应用程序。Vue还有详细的文档和丰富的教程,为开发者提供了很多学习资源。

    2. Vue采用了组件化的开发方式,将应用程序划分为多个独立的组件。每个组件都有自己的逻辑和模板,可以独立开发和维护。这样可以提高代码的可重用性和可维护性,同时也使得开发过程更加清晰和高效。

    3. Vue具有响应式的数据绑定机制。开发者可以轻松地将数据和视图进行绑定,当数据发生变化时,视图会自动进行更新。这样可以减少手动操作DOM的次数,提高开发效率,并增加用户体验。

    4. Vue提供了丰富的功能和工具来处理用户交互。它有强大的指令系统,可以通过指令来处理各种用户操作。另外,Vue还提供了丰富的插件和组件库,可以扩展框架的功能和样式。

    5. Vue具有良好的性能和可扩展性。它采用了虚拟DOM技术,可以在需要更新视图时,只更新改变的部分而不是整个视图。这样可以减少不必要的操作,提高性能。另外,Vue还支持懒加载和代码分割等功能,可以优化应用程序的加载速度。

    总之,Vue提供了简单、高效、灵活和可扩展的方式来构建应用程序。它在前端开发领域得到了广泛的应用,并且拥有庞大而活跃的社区支持。无论是开发小型项目还是大型应用程序,Vue都是一个值得考虑的选择。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ue是一种用于构建用户界面的渐进式JavaScript框架。它允许开发者通过使用组件化思维来构建复杂的应用程序,并在界面与数据之间建立起强大的响应式关系。Vue具有以下特点:

    1. 渐进式框架:Vue可以逐步采用,适用于各种规模的项目,从简单的交互式页面到大型单页应用。

    2. 组件化开发:Vue支持将应用程序划分为多个可重用、独立的组件,每个组件都有自己的逻辑和模板。这样可以提高应用程序的可维护性和可测试性。

    3. 响应式数据绑定:Vue使用双向绑定的方式来自动追踪和更新数据变化,使开发者无需手动操作DOM。当数据发生变化时,Vue会自动更新相应的视图部分。

    4. 虚拟DOM:Vue使用虚拟DOM来优化页面渲染性能。虚拟DOM是一个轻量级的JavaScript对象,可以高效地表示页面的结构和状态。Vue会根据数据的变化,自动更新虚拟DOM,然后比较新旧虚拟DOM的差异,最后只更新需要更新的部分。

    5. 插件系统:Vue具有丰富的插件系统,可以扩展其功能。开发者可以选择性地引入第三方插件,或者编写自己的插件,以满足特定的需求。

    下面是使用Vue构建应用程序的基本流程:

    1. 引入Vue:在HTML文件中,通过<script>标签引入Vue库。

    2. 创建Vue实例:通过调用Vue构造函数创建一个Vue实例,可以传入一个选项对象来配置实例的行为。

    3. 定义数据:在选项对象中的data属性中定义需要响应式追踪的数据。

    4. 定义模板:在选项对象中的template属性中定义应用程序的模板。模板可以使用Vue的模板语法,包括插值表达式、指令等。

    5. 挂载DOM:通过调用Vue实例的$mount方法,将实例挂载到一个指定的元素上,使其成为该元素的子节点。

    6. 响应式数据绑定:在模板中使用插值表达式或指令,将数据绑定到相应的视图部分。当数据变化时,视图会自动响应更新。

    7. 交互操作:可以通过指令、事件监听等方式,为模板中的元素添加交互行为。

    8. 完成应用程序的其他功能:可以通过使用Vue的一些特性,如组件、路由、状态管理等,来实现应用程序的其他功能。

    9. 部署应用程序:将Vue应用程序打包,并将打包后的文件部署到服务器上,使用户可以访问和使用。

    以上是使用Vue构建应用程序的基本流程,开发者可以根据具体的需求和项目的规模,选择合适的开发方式和工具。通过学习和实践,开发者可以更深入地理解Vue的特性和使用方法,并运用它来创造出更加优秀的用户界面。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部